Job Description – Sr. Manager (eCommerce Team)
Develop the organization’s SEO strategy, identify SEO success metrics, and have responsibility for ongoing optimization efforts to drive traffic and sales. by identifying and improving organic search KPIs.Own the corporate-wide SEO roadmap and define the tactics to achieve the SEO strategy.Align JCG’s content and technical SEO implementation with Google’s algorithmic priorities, such as EEAT, Core Updates, Helpful Content Updates, and Natural Language Processing/Entity-Based approach (BERT).Demonstrate a proven ability to quantify LOE vs. ROI for SEO action items, especially in the context of the overall product roadmap. Partner with eCommerce technology teams to optimize websites for SEO. Scope includes, but is not limited to, URL structure, site map, indexing, JavaScript rendering, crawl budget management, internal linking, and more.Partner with the creative and content delivery teams to develop and implement SEO strategies. Review content on a regular basis to identify opportunities, points of improvement, and creative solutions for SEO.Partner with the merchandising team to optimize copy (e.g. product names, destinations, etc.) for SEO.Continually audit the sites, monitor activity, analyze performance, identify areas of opportunity and recommend ways to drive traffic and improve KPIs.Partner with external SEO vendors on SEO strategies, workflows, and improvement opportunities.Actively participate in the global SEO community to stay current on SEO trends and to gather new SEO skills that will give the business a competitive edge.Collaborate with PPC business owners and vendors to align SEO and SEM strategies and tactics.Review and report on results through dashboards and regular updates, including to the senior leadership team.Prepare and lead content pitches and other SEO strategy proposals delivered to Marketing and eCommerce leadership teams.Develop a plan for JCG to successfully transition into AI-based search generative experiences.Regularly provide SEO trainings for dev, product and editorial teamsEmploy the use of SEO tools such as SEMrush, Screaming Frog, Sitebulb, Ahrefs, etc. to identify trends, issues, and opportunities to further optimize SEO.Prerequisites
5+ years of proven experience leading SEO strategy and execution; seniority is critical. Deep understanding of Google’s patterns of behavior and expectations.
Experience: The candidate must have a proven and successful track record in the design and delivery of SEO plans and strategies in fast-paced businesses, preferably performing the functions of a technical SEO lead. In addition, a suitable candidate will have had substantial experience working in a managerial position involving a team in, either an SEO, Content Editing, or Content Marketing capacity. The SEO will have a proven ability to take responsibility and sensibly account for a team’s performance. As a bonus, the role will also have experience in influencer marketing and have a passion for all things social in the business’s market field.
Analytical Skills: This role also portrays great analytical skills and can draw insight from raw information and data acquired through field research. The Sr. Manager will have the ability to analyze data for the purpose of determining SEO strategies, approaches, and content planning. The candidate will also demonstrate an ability to conduct SEO analyses for trends, links, and influencers. SEO Sr. Manager will also demonstrate an intimate understanding and interest in analytical tools such as Adobe Analytics, Google Analytics, SEMRush, Google Search Console and others.
A suitable candidate for this position will not only demonstrate great understanding of SEO but also of various digital marketing channels, for example, PR, web development, content creation, social media, on-site usability, off-site optimization, among others. In addition the Sr. Manager will show familiarity with HTML, JavaScript, AJAX CSS, and other valuable media technologies.
Leadership/People Skills: The candidate must demonstrate exceptional leadership skills. A suitable candidate will have a strong ability to encourage and motivate a cross-functional team into working towards a unified vision and objective.
